@@ -32,6 +32,27 @@
 #include <crt_externs.h>
 
 
+// Returns the screen that is specified by a displayID
+//
+static NSScreen *getScreen(CGDirectDisplayID displayID)
+{
+    // NOTE: Apple's documentation of [NSScreen screens] mentions that,
+    //       "The (screens) array should not be cached. Screens can be
+    //       added, removed, or dynamically reconfigured at any time."
+    //       Because of this, we simply obtain the screen from a
+    //       displayID whenever we need it.
+    NSArray *screens = [NSScreen screens];
+
+    for(NSScreen *screen in screens) {
+        NSDictionary *dictionary = [screen deviceDescription];
+        NSNumber     *number     = [dictionary objectForKey:@"NSScreenNumber"];
+        if ([number unsignedIntegerValue] == displayID)
+            return screen;
+    }
+
+    return nil;
+}
+
